Seba_K pisze:A czasem nie powinieneś się podłączyć poprzez wyjście RS232/TTL to wyjście jest na dole patrz rysunek na stronie http://atnel.pl/atb-usb-rs232.html bo teraz łączysz się poprzez ISP według tego co piszesz
być może tak, tylko pytanie co do czego?
Jeśli dobrze rozumiem wyjście RS232/TTL -> podpinałem jako FTDI linie rx,tx dts i gnd
a kanda poprzez kabelek do 6pinowego isp w rx wykonany wg tego rysunku:
Oczywiście nie w tym samym czasie i tylko komunikacje bez podawania + zasilania.
Pozdrawiam
kamilt
1% - http://www.dzieciom.pl/12659
************************************
różne latające + wiatrak
Korzystając wyłącznie z konfiguratora zawartego w Chrome
Potrzebny jest konwerter rs232-ttl(max232) lub usb-uart(ftdi). Ważne aby konwerter nie dał więcej niż 3,3V na płytę orange. Podłączasz tx, rx i masę. Włączasz zasilanie orange, odpalasz konfigurator i ustawiasz port com na którym masz swój konwerter. Podpinasz luźny przewód pod DTR w orange i drugi koniec trzymasz blisko masy. Dajesz "connect" w konfiguratorze, powinno pójść. Jeśli nie idzie dajesz impuls masy na DTR. Jak nie idzie to na DTR dajesz na chwilę 3V, a potem powtarzasz całą procedurę.
Dobry poradnik - sporo pomógł.
Warto by zrobić aktualizację do nowej biblioteki, bo tamtej niebawem wybije rok.
Można też dodać informację, iż gdyż programując USBasp przestawionym na 3.3V nie trzeba zewnętrznego zasilania - wszystko ładnie się zaprogramowało zasilane po złączu ISP (TX 1W oraz RX)
zielek pisze:Dobry poradnik - sporo pomógł.
Warto by zrobić aktualizację do nowej biblioteki, bo tamtej niebawem wybije rok.
Można też dodać informację, iż gdyż programując USBasp przestawionym na 3.3V nie trzeba zewnętrznego zasilania - wszystko ładnie się zaprogramowało zasilane po złączu ISP (TX 1W oraz RX)
Generalnie teraz robi się to o wiele prościej, nie trzeba nic kompilować, zmieniać w kodzie. Instaluje się chrome, openlrsng configurator i można wszystko ładnie wyklikać.
Hej
Zgodnie z obietnica zrobiłem testy, niestety nadal nic się nie zmieniło
programator: atb-FT232R
zasilanie pakiet 6V podłączony do jednego z wyjść serwa
Na programatorze zworka zasilania zdjęta, pwr ext, vccio na wszelki 3,3V
zapinanie czy zdejmowanie zworki dla max232 w programatorze atb-FT232R nie zauważyłem wpływu na prace programatora
połączenia:
sygnał tx z 1 pinu rs232/ttl na 3 pin złącza obok anteny od anteny licząc
sygnał rx z 2 pinu rs232/ttl na 2 pin złącza obok anteny od anteny licząc
gnd z 12 pinu rs232/ttl na 5 pin złącza obok anteny od anteny licząc
podawanie impulsów masy poza chwilowym przygaśnięciem diod na rx orange lrs nic nie dawało, podawanie plus 3,0V nawet teg.
Kilka prób podpięcia dało taki mniej więcej efekt:
22:24:04 -- Running - OS: Windows, Chrome 35.0.1916.153, Configurator: 0.45.1
22:24:04 -- Are you using ESCs with SimonK firmware? Try RapidFlash, our new utility for configuring / flashing / updating firmware.
22:24:07 -- Serial port successfully opened with ID: 1
22:24:17 -- Start message not received within 10 seconds, disconnecting
22:24:17 -- Serial port successfully closed
22:24:22 -- Serial port successfully opened with ID: 2
22:24:33 -- Start message not received within 10 seconds, disconnecting
22:24:33 -- Serial port successfully closed
22:24:37 -- Serial port successfully opened with ID: 3
22:24:48 -- Start message not received within 10 seconds, disconnecting
22:24:48 -- Serial port successfully closed
22:24:53 -- Serial port successfully opened with ID: 4
22:25:04 -- Start message not received within 10 seconds, disconnecting
22:25:04 -- Serial port successfully closed
22:25:14 -- Serial port successfully opened with ID: 5
22:25:25 -- Start message not received within 10 seconds, disconnecting
22:25:25 -- Serial port successfully closed
Na MkAvCalculator przy tym samym podpięciu podczas próby sprawdź podłączony avr
albo nie pokazywała nic poza :Bład avrdude - nie odpowiada podczas próby dostępu do portu ft0, a najlepszym przypadku udało mi się uzyskać inny komunikat:
avrdude: BitBang OK
avrdude: pin assign miso 3 sck 5 mosi 6 reset 7
avrdude: drain OK
ft245r: bitclk 230400 -> ft baud 115200
ft245r: bitclk 230400 -> ft baud 115200
avrdude: ft245r_program_enable: failed
avrdude: initialization failed, rc=-1
Double check connections and try again, or use -F to override
this check.
Po tym opadła mi szczeka, bo atb-FT232R zgodnie ze wszystkimi zworkami ustawiony był do pracy jako rs232 ttl
Na dziś tyle, dzięki za porady i sugestie, jutro będę walczył dalej.
Pozdrawiam
kamilt
1% - http://www.dzieciom.pl/12659
************************************
różne latające + wiatrak
A sprawdź czy w ogóle dane Ci wychodzą z konwertera i do niego wracają. Zwierasz TX z RX i gdy w putty wciśniesz jakąś literę to masz ją widzieć. Jeśli nie widzisz tzn. że dane nie przepływają.
przez windowy hyper terminal i ustawieniu portu na com odpowiedzialny za programator podczas wysłania czegokolwiek miga naraz tx i rx wiec teoretycznie chociaż powinno być ok,
Z braku czasów niestety reszta testów jutro
Pozdrawiam
kamilt
1% - http://www.dzieciom.pl/12659
************************************
różne latające + wiatrak
m_atrix pisze:sygnał tx z 1 pinu rs232/ttl na 3 pin złącza obok anteny od anteny licząc
sygnał rx z 2 pinu rs232/ttl na 2 pin złącza obok anteny od anteny licząc
Jesteś pewien, że podłączasz TX programatora do RX orange'a i RX programatora do TX orange'a? Nie mam go teraz przy sobie, ale spojrzałem na szybko na diagram z neta i chyba podłączasz odwrotnie.
m_atrix pisze:sygnał tx z 1 pinu rs232/ttl na 3 pin złącza obok anteny od anteny licząc
sygnał rx z 2 pinu rs232/ttl na 2 pin złącza obok anteny od anteny licząc
Jesteś pewien, że podłączasz TX programatora do RX orange'a i RX programatora do TX orange'a? Nie mam go teraz przy sobie, ale spojrzałem na szybko na diagram z neta i chyba podłączasz odwrotnie.
Wydaje mi sie ze posprawdzałem te 3 połączenia na wszelki możliwe sposoby pod kątem poprawności, nawet nie tyle po rysunkach co po oznaczeniach na płytkach, kablem ma w rożnych kolorach, wiec tu o pomyłce nie może być mowy, być może po prostu trafiony jest programator, bo jak na złość orange lrs nadal dział tyle ze na archaicznym oryginalnym sofcie, który to właśnie chciałem zmienić i po-testować ustrojstwo na skrzydle,a przy okazji złapać trochę obycia pod kątem późniejszej obsługi innych eleres'ow
Pozdrawiam
kamilt
1% - http://www.dzieciom.pl/12659
************************************
różne latające + wiatrak
skazi pisze:Ok, już śmiga przez przypadek wgrywałem soft do tego nowego 4 kanałowego odbiornika DTF UHF (bo był on domyślnie ustawiony w sofcie na stronie)
Polecam ten programik, można w nim sobie "wyklikać" wszystkie ustawienia zarówno w TX jak i RX( zamiast ustawiać to sobie w menu).
Powiedzcie Pany - to trzeba taki wynalazek http://allegro.pl/konwerter-usb-rs232-f ... 69400.html ?
+ ten programik i ogarnę podstawową konfigurację na tyle że będzie bezpieczne - w sensie nikt się nie wetnie?
PS. Czy ja dobrze rozumiem - trzeba ustawiać w nadajniku, a nadajnik sam wyśle ustawienia do odbiornika czy można oba osobno?
Ja mam dokladnie ten modol co podlinkowales. Musisz tam dolutowac sobie pin dtr by sie nadawal. A konfiguracja to polaczyc nadajnik z kompem( ja mam caly czas w aparaturze i podlaczam tylko piny rx, tx i dtr), w konfiguratorze naciskasz na rx i masz chyba 30 sec na podlaczenie zasilania do odbiornika by mozna bylo go konfigurowac
Możesz rozwinąć co to ten dtr gdzie jak to dolutować? Albo co kupić żeby na gotowo podłączyć?
Może to by było lepsze http://www.hobbyking.com/hobbyking/stor ... odule.html ? Tylko nie chce mi się czekać znowu miesiąc.
Akurat ten programator z HK się nie nadaje. Ja używam tego http://www.hobbyking.com/hobbyking/stor ... er_5V.html - jest okej, tylko trzeba pamiętać żeby nie podłączać z niego zasilania.
W takim trzeba podłączyć cztery piny - GND, TX, RX, i DTR - ten ostatni służy do resetowania płytki - można to zrobić ręcznie - czyli podłączyć zasilanie w odpowiednim momencie.
W tej płyce z Allegro DTR jest z boku i musisz to połączyć z płyką czymkolwiek - kawałkiem kabla z koncówką od serwa.